TeSys D suppressor module, for contactors LC1D09-D38, LC1DT20-DT40 and control relays CAD. To be used with 5-600V DC control circuit voltage, it provides a flywheel diode protection ensuring no transient overvoltage. Clip-on side mounting, overall size of the contactor is unchanged. Green Premium compliant (RoHS/REACh).
